Requirements:
Month-End Close & Financial Reporting
-
Lead the month-end close process, including journal entries, accruals, reconciliations, and financial statement preparation.
-
Ensure accuracy and integrity of the general ledger in accordance with GAAP.
-
Prepare supporting schedules, variance analyses, and internal financial reports.
Debt, Interest & Cash Management
-
Maintain detailed schedules for company debt, including loans, lines of credit, and other financing arrangements.
-
Record and reconcile interest expense, amortization, and principal activity.
-
Perform cash reconciliations, monitor cash balances, and support cash flow reporting.
Sales & Use Tax (Multi-State)
-
Prepare, review, and file sales and use tax returns across multiple states.
-
Monitor nexus issues, exemption certificates, and compliance requirements.
-
Respond to tax notices and support audits when necessary.
Reconciliations & Analysis
-
Complete monthly balance sheet and bank reconciliations.
-
Investigate discrepancies, identify root causes, and recommend corrective actions.
-
Ensure timely resolution of reconciling items.
-
Systems, Processes & Collaboration
-
Utilize QuickBooks for daily accounting activities and reporting.
-
Leverage advanced Excel skills to build and maintain schedules, models, and analyses (pivot tables, lookups, formulas).
-
Collaborate with internal teams to support operational and financial accuracy.
-
Assist with audits, process improvements, and documentation of internal controls.
Audit, Internal Controls & Compliance
-
Assist with annual audits, preparing documentation and responding to auditor requests.
-
Maintain strong internal controls and contribute to process improvements.
-
Ensure compliance with company policies and construction-specific financial standards.
